Montague Dawson

British 1890 - 1973

Trade Winds, the China Tea Clipper Titania



signed lower left: Montague. Dawson.; titled and inscribed indistinctly on the reverse

oil on canvas

canvas: 24 by 36 in.; 61 by 91.4 cm

framed: 30 ½ by 42 ⅝ in.; 77.5 by 108.3 cm

Executed circa 1942.

With Frost & Reed Ltd., London (inv. no. MD103)

Private Collection, Chicago

Thence by descent to the present owner

The Titania was built by Robert Steele & Co. in Greenock, Scotland in 1866 and sailed from Shanghai to London in 98 days in 1869, beating the great clipper Thermopylae.
